This task is designed to assess how well students understand geometrical proofs.

The task presents three attempts to prove Pythagoras’ theorem. Students must look carefully at each attempt and determine which is the best ‘proof’. They must explain their reasoning as fully as possible.

This short task considers reasoning with equations and inequalities. Students answer a series of six questions, including working with solution sets for pairs of inequalities, and sketching the solution set of a system of four inequalities. 

The resource comes with a detailed rubric for each question.

This resource features a short task on different representations of functions.

Students are presented with a matching exercise in which they must link together equations, tables of values, worded statements, and graphs for both linear and quadratic functions.
